How to uninstall or remove hydra software package from Ubuntu 14.04 LTS (Trusty Tahr)

You can uninstall or removes an installed hydra package itself from Ubuntu 14.04 LTS (Trusty Tahr) through the terminal,

$ sudo apt-get remove hydra 

Uninstall hydra including dependent package

If you would like to remove hydra and it's dependent packages which are no longer needed from Ubuntu,

$ sudo apt-get remove --auto-remove hydra 
Use Purging hydra

If you use with purge options to hydra package all the configuration and dependent packages will be removed.

$ sudo apt-get purge hydra 

If you use purge options along with auto remove, will be removed everything regarding the package, It's really useful when you want to reinstall again.

$ sudo apt-get purge --auto-remove hydra
